viewwillappear

    0热度

    1回答

    我在viewwillappear方法中有几行代码。我只想执行一次该代码。我怎样才能做到这一点。但是,这段代码在循环中。 CALayer *myLayer = btn.layer; myLayer.borderColor = [UIColor blackColor].CGColor; myLayer.masksToBounds=NO; myLayer.borderWidth = 2.0; myLay

    0热度

    4回答

    我有一个应用程序,其中有3个选项卡来计算距离和所有。当我第一次启动应用程序时,在点击第3个标签页时,正在发生一些网络通话。现在我把应用程序放到后台。 当应用程序到达前台时,应该调用viewwillappear再次进入网络调用。但它没有发生。它并没有叫viewwillappear。 如何检查,当应用程序涉及到前台,就应检查第三个标签,并呼吁网络方法 请帮我

    1热度

    1回答

    我使用的UITableViewController子类clearsSelectionOnViewWillAppear设置为YES(默认值)。 如何在取消选中的单元格在viewWillAppear:上自动取消选中时对其进行更改?

    0热度

    1回答

    我在做一些iOS 5教程,在几个教程中,它说MasterViewController.m中的“在viewWillAppear结尾添加”或“修改viewWillDisappear”,但在我的项目中,MasterViewController.m没有任何这些方法。 因为它没有说“创建这些方法”,我猜他们是由某些东西自动创建的,但我不知道我需要做什么才能让它们出现在MasterViewController

    0热度

    2回答

    后,当我进入前景后viewWillAppear中没有被调用任何一个可以指导我我怎么能激发我的viewWillAppear中方法的前景后 感谢提前

    1热度

    1回答

    我有一个视图控制器,这是一个UINavigationController,在某些时候推动(navigationcontroller pushViewController: animated:)第二个视图,后来推第三个视图,我有一个按钮,弹出回到根视图(popToRootViewController: animated:)。问题是在视图回到根目录之后,根视图的方法viewWillApper未被调用。

    4热度

    1回答

    这个问题非常频繁,但我无法解决任何可用的答案。 我正在使用iOS 5.1。我的导航控制器是标签栏视图控制器中的一个选项卡。有一个tableview,其中选择一行推动新的视图控制器。 仅在选择第二行时才会发生此问题,并且有时会出现此问题。这并不经常。 推送视图空白 - viewWillAppear/viewDidAppear未被调用。点击导航栏的后退按钮 - 根视图的viewWillAppear/v

    3热度

    4回答

    从UIActionSheet按钮启动视图时,通过导航栏后退按钮返回视图时,仍然可见的工具栏上没有任何先前位于其上的按钮。自升级到iOS 6后出现此错误,并且仅在运行iOS 6的模拟器和设备上进行测试时出现此错误。如果我注释掉在UIActionSheet推送的视图上隐藏工具栏的代码,则在返回时会添加按钮。 我正在通过编程方式在viewWillAppear中制作我的工具栏项目,并在我正在通过self.

    -1热度

    1回答

    我在横向模式下启动我的应用程序(iPhone和iPand)。 我viewDidAppear发现为iPad帧改变该帧在,比viewWillAppear中一个在。 IOS IPAD 5.1模拟器 在viewWillAppear中它是0.000000 20.000000 768.000000 1004.000000。 同时,在viewDidAppear它是0.000000 0.000000 748.00

    2热度

    1回答

    我有两个类。让我们说A,B类。从A类pushviewController被调用,然后会出现B类。那么这就是问题所在。当我从B类调用popviewcontrolleranimated方法时,它将返回到A,但是随后这两个类的viewwillaapar方法被调用。所以任何人都可以告诉我这里发生了什么事。我卡住了! 下面是A班。 @implementation ShakeViewController